Abstract

The control apparatus comprises, in its version intended for a double-clutch transmission with six or seven forward gears and one reverse gear, a first shift fork for engaging the first gear or the third gear, respectively, a second shift fork for engaging the reverse gear or the fifth gear, respectively, a first hydraulic actuator arranged to control the movement of the first shift fork, a second hydraulic actuator arranged to control the movement of the second shift fork, a selection slide valve which can be moved into a first operating position in which the first hydraulic actuator is selected and a second operating position in which the second hydraulic actuator is selected, a pilot solenoid valve for controlling the movement of the slide valve between the first and second operating positions, and first and second gear shift solenoid valves for controlling the supply of fluid to the hydraulic actuator each time selected by the slide valve or the connection of said actuator with a tank.
